About

Neerja Goel is a scholar working on Obstetrics and Gynecology,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Neerja Goel has authored 57 papers receiving a total of 404 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Obstetrics and Gynecology, 13 papers in Surgery and 12 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Neerja Goel’s work include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(7 papers), Uterine Myomas and Treatments (7 papers) and Cervical Cancer and HPV Research (6 papers). Neerja Goel is often cited by papers focused on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(7 papers), Uterine Myomas and Treatments (7 papers) and Cervical Cancer and HPV Research (6 papers). Neerja Goel collaborates with scholars based in India, United States and Poland. Neerja Goel's co-authors include Shalini Rajaram, Sumita Mehta, Farah Khaliq, O P Tandon, Ashok Kumar Saxena, Rachna Agarwal, Bindiya Gupta, Sarika Gupta, Sarla Agarwal and Neera Agarwal and has published in prestigious journals such as BJOG An International Journal of Obstetrics & Gynaecology, International Journal of Gynecology & Obstetrics and Obstetrical & Gynecological Survey.
